Fan-out backpressure for the Quillet notifier: when the queue depth crosses the soft limit, the dispatcher sheds low-priority pushes and batches the rest at 500ms intervals. Reviewer should confirm the shed counter is exported and that retries respect the jitter window. Once merged, the release artifact gets re-signed by the pipeline, which expects the deploy key shown below.

deploy key for bawep-yawif: bky6_GQhaSt

Subject: Gallery labels for Halveston Museum

Dispatch — the printed labels for the new Tidal Histories gallery are boxed and waiting at the front desk. They're on archival card, so keep the box flat and dry. Delivery window is before 10:00 Friday, straight to the curatorial office on the second floor. Nothing else rides with this run. Please make sure your driver follows the hand-over instruction directly below:

handover note for yagef-bagep: the drudor pelius courier leaves the kasdor zorvan norir ledger at gate 8016 under passcode 755406

Inventory reconciliation on Copperline runs nightly via the `recon-sync` job. Required variables: `RECON_DB_URL`, `RECON_BATCH_SIZE` (default 500), `RECON_DRY_RUN` (set to `false` in prod). The job compares warehouse counts from the Stockhaven feed against the ledger and writes diffs to the audit table. Do not run it against prod without sign-off. One more variable is mandatory: the upstream feed credential. Place it in `.env.recon` on the line immediately below.

secret setting of hawep-yahig: LEDGER_TOKEN29=41b5d6315371c92885eaeb077fb63